2010 was the last big year for the Air Jordan VI, during which we got treated to OG looks via the Infrared Pack as well as a good number of brand new colorways. Noticeably absent however was the Air Jordan VI ‘Carmine’ which last popped up in the countdown pack release of 2008. Fortunately we’ve spotted a pair up for grabs with a very special embellishment. The line up of autographed Air Jordans has been pretty strong as of late, but do you ever seen yourself putting down the dough for this kind of a collection piece? An argument can be made for both sides, in what eventually boils down to the old rock ’em vs. stock ’em debate.
